Twenty-second Sunday in Ordinary Time TODAY’S READINGS First Reading-Conduct your affairs with humility and God will favor you (Sirach 3:17-18,20,28-29) Psalm-God, in your goodness, you have made a home for the poor (Psalm 68) Second Reading-You have approached Jesus, the mediator of a new covenant (Hebrews 12:18-19,22-24a) Gospel–When invited to dine, take the lowest place. Those who humble themselves will be exalted (Luke 14:1,7-14) HUMILITY Today’s readings praise the virtue of humility and offer concrete ways for us to become more humble. The Book of Sirach suggests a practical reason for acting with humility: humble people are more likeable than the arrogant. Even God “finds favor” with those who humble themselves. In Luke’s Gospel, Jesus provides real-world suggestions for growing in humility and teaches us never to assume we are better than others. His words change our outward behavior and expand our hearts and minds to care about people we might have dismissed before. This practical, almost “folksy” wisdom about humility helps us behave better in daily life and makes our lofty goal of eternal life more accessible. Our reading from Hebrews affirms that heaven is indeed approachable. The personal love and sacrifice of Jesus have opened “the city of the living God” to us. Humility prepares us for paradise.
